Cumulative Relative Frequency
A calculation used in statistics to summarize data by accumulating percentages of observations in ascending order.
Proportion
A part or fraction of a whole, often expressed as a percentage or decimal.
Upper Limit
The maximum value in a range or set, beyond which no observations in the data set fall or are allowed.
Relative Frequency Distribution
A tabular summary of data showing the fraction or proportion of observations in each of several nonoverlapping categories or classes.
